当前位置: 首页 > news >正文

独立商城系统网站建设/制作网页的工具软件

在现代网页开发中,SEO(搜索引擎优化)是提升网站可见性和获取更多流量的关键。然而,由于 Vue.js 作为一个前端框架主要处理客户端渲染,这给 SEO 带来了挑战。在这篇文章中,我们将探讨如何优化 Vue.js 网站的 SEO,确保你的内容能够被搜索引擎正确抓取和索引。

1. 使用服务器端渲染(SSR)

服务器端渲染是优化 Vue.js 网站 SEO 的一个重要策略。通过在服务器上渲染页面,你可以确保搜索引擎爬虫在抓取网站时能看到完全渲染的内容,而不是仅仅抓取到初始的空 HTML。

  • 使用 Nuxt.js: Nuxt.js 是一个基于 Vue.js 的框架,提供了内置的服务器端渲染功能。通过使用 Nuxt.js,你可以轻松实现服务器端渲染,提升 SEO 性能。
  • 自定义 SSR 解决方案: 如果你不使用 Nuxt.js,可以通过 vue-server-renderer 来实现自定义的服务器端渲染方案。

2. 生成静态站点

对于一些内容相对固定的网站,生成静态站点是一种有效的 SEO 优化方法。静态站点在构建时生成完整的 HTML 文件,这样搜索引擎能够直接抓取这些静态页面。

  • 使用 VuePress: VuePress 是一个为 Vue.js 开发的静态站点生成器,适用于创建文档网站和网站。它支持生成 SEO 友好的静态 HTML 文件。

3. 优化 Meta 标签和结构

优化页面的 Meta 标签和结构对于 SEO 非常重要。确保每个页面都有独特且相关的标题、描述和关键字。

  • 动态 Meta 标签: 使用 Vue Router 的 meta 字段动态设置每个页面的标题和描述。可以通过 vue-meta 库来管理和注入 Meta 标签。

    // 在 Vue Router 配置中设置 meta 标签 const routes = [ { path: '/example', component: ExamplePage, meta: { title: 'Example Page - My Site', description: 'This is an example page description' } } ];

  • 结构化数据: 使用 Schema.org 的结构化数据标记来帮助搜索引擎更好地理解你的内容。例如,使用 JSON-LD 来嵌入结构化数据。

    <script type="application/ld+json"> {     "@context": "https://schema.org",     "@type": "Product",     "name": "Example Product",     "description": "This is an example product description",     "sku": "12345",     "offers": {             "@type": "Offer",             "priceCurrency": "USD",              "price": "19.99"             } } </script>

4. 实现路由懒加载

虽然路由懒加载主要是为了性能优化,但它也可以间接提高 SEO。通过懒加载路由组件,你可以缩短初始页面加载时间,这对用户体验和搜索引擎排名都有好处。

  • 使用 Vue Router 的懒加载:

    const ExamplePage = () => import('./components/ExamplePage.vue'); const routes = [ { path: '/example', component: ExamplePage } ];

5. 创建站点地图

站点地图是一个包含网站所有页面链接的文件,有助于搜索引擎爬虫发现和抓取你的所有页面。

  • 使用 sitemap 插件: 在 Nuxt.js 中,可以使用 @nuxtjs/sitemap 插件自动生成站点地图。

     // nuxt.config.js export default { modules: [ '@nuxtjs/sitemap' ], sitemap: { hostname: 'https://example.com', gzip: true, routes: [ '/page-1', '/page-2', '/page-3' ] } }

6. 确保网站响应式设计

移动友好的设计对 SEO 至关重要。确保你的网站在各种设备上都能良好展示。

  • 使用响应式设计: 确保使用响应式布局和媒体查询,使网站在手机、平板和桌面设备上都能正常显示。

7. 监控和优化页面性能

页面加载速度是 SEO 的一个重要因素。确保你的网站性能良好,以提升用户体验和搜索引擎排名。

  • 使用工具监控性能: 使用 Google PageSpeed Insights 或 Lighthouse 等工具来检测和优化页面性能。

结论

优化 Vue.js 网站的 SEO 需要综合考虑多个因素,包括服务器端渲染、静态站点生成、Meta 标签优化、路由懒加载、站点地图创建、响应式设计和页面性能监控。通过实施这些策略,你可以提升网站的可见性,并获得更多的流量和用户。无论你是刚开始学习 SEO 还是希望进一步优化现有网站,这些技巧都能帮助你实现更好的 SEO 成果。希望这篇文章对你有帮助!

相关文章:

  • 小程序商城开发商华网天下北京/成都seo整站
  • 站群系统有哪些/电子商务seo
  • 商城网站模板免费下载/seo搜索引擎优化策略
  • 网站统计系统怎么做/南宁seo外包服务商
  • 如何开始一个链接建设活动快速(和系统化的一切)
  • 做外贸的网站b2c/seo扣费系统
  • 在线商城网站建设/系列推广软文范例
  • 商丘网站制作/电脑系统优化软件十大排名
  • 商城网站建设定制/百度商城app下载
  • 国内做微商城比较知名的网站/网络营销的发展概述
  • 可靠的微商城网站建设/上海企业推广
  • 东莞商城网站建设公司/陕西网站关键词自然排名优化